The US is running out of ammunition. They don't know what to do next with Iran. This was stated on the air of the Silicon Curtain video blog by Ben Hodges, the former commander of American troops in Europe, PolitNavigator reports.
According to the general, due to the war unleashed by the Trump administration with Iran, ammunition stocks are being depleted in American warehouses, with which there were already problems due to the Ukrainian conflict. However, now this issue has become more acute.
"Of course, the real reserves of what we have, and what, according to our calculations, we have to use up, are classified. But over the past few days, there have been many reports that there are concerns about their number," Hodges said.
He noted that the rate of ammunition consumption depends on the tasks set. However, in the absence of a clear understanding of the purpose of the war, it is difficult to predict the need for them.
"And, of course, one of the excuses for not helping Ukraine more has always been the concern that the United States itself does not have enough resources," Hodges further said.
He expressed confidence that there are not enough reserves.
"The real expense should depend on the tasks set. We don't have a clear understanding of the goal. And finally, you always need more ammunition than you think," Hodges concluded.
